WebRecipe Tips. To make ahead, simply remove the vegetables from the oven 5 minutes before the end of the cooking time. Leave to cool, then transfer to the freezer. WebParboil the parsnips in boiling salted water for 10 minutes, then drain well. Pick the thyme leaves. Toss the parsnips with the honey, thyme, a pinch of sea salt and black pepper, 10g of the butter and 2 tablespoons of oil. Tip into a roasting tray and arrange in one layer, then roast for 40 minutes, or until golden.
